Goal

The goal of Serve-One, Inc., is first to provide food and other basic needs to those who cannot come to facility-based services due to physical, social, or economic reasons.   These include the young/elderly, shut-ins, the medically disabled (many Vets), transitory or severely impoverished.  These much-ignored groups generally have impaired mobility or are otherwise handicapped by insufficient transportation and/or unable to avail themselves of the many services offered at fixed locations throughout the city and state.

Faith Based VS Faith Run

Faith Based: Is defined as; affiliated with, supported by, or based on a religion or religious group.

Faith Run or Administered: is defined as; A management approach that includes Christian principles but excludes no one from participating.

 When filing for our tax exempt status, Serve-One chose NOT to apply for a Faith Based classification in order not to limit its services or influences to any outside political or religious entity.  Just as the community we serve….our management team is diverse and non-denominational and our volunteers are the same.

Method

Provide mobile food services supporting the needs of the community.

In May 2013 Serve-One, incorporated in the State of California, filed for a declaration of Public Charity with the IRS (EIN# 46-2264700) and purchased a mobile 20’ car hauler with extensive height and load modifications. This trailer serves to transport food for distribution (pantry) or our complete propane fired mobile kitchen, which is set-up on location to prepare and distribute complete, hot, and wholesome meals to areas where the needs are not mobile, such as; mobile shelters, riverbeds and other homeless encampments as well as wilderness inhabitants, dayroom motels, seniors and section 8 housing.  It also doubles as an emergency response kitchen, in case of local or national disasters.  When fully staffed, the pantry/kitchen is capable of providing the community with hundreds of prepared and/or pantry meals a day.

Serve-One, Inc. (S-1) is completely Volunteer run.  All services are done by volunteers.  There are no paid staff or employees and 100% of any donation goes towards our mission.  Additionally we are a 100% cash organization and pay all applicable State and Local taxes at the time and place products and/or services are rendered.
